Bhubaneswar: BJD on Thursday said it has moved the Chief Electoral Officer (CEO) of Odisha with new videos of BJP Khurda MLA candidate Prashant Jagdev allegedly threatening poll officials on duty.
In the memorandum submitted along with evidence in the form of videos, senior BJD leaders alleged that Jagdev disrupted the voting process in booth 114 at Kaunripatna in Bolagad blocks of Begunia Assembly constituency.
They alleged that the BJP candidate assaulted the presiding officer and threatened him.
They further complained that other BJP leaders of Khurda are also threatening government officials on poll duty and warning them of transfer and punitive action.
The party leaders also expressed dissatisfaction that despite CCTV footage of such threats available with the Election Commission, no action has been taken against the BJP leaders.
